Principais responsabilidades
Conceber, desenvolver e manter aplicações backend robustas utilizando Java.
Criar microsserviços e APIs escaláveis e de alto desempenho.
Participar em revisões de código e contribuir para as melhores práticas de desenvolvimento.
Garantir o desempenho, a qualidade e a capacidade de resposta das aplicações.
Identificar e resolver problemas técnicos ao longo de todo o ciclo de vida do desenvolvimento de software.
Contribuir para iniciativas de melhoria contínua e inovação técnica.
Competências e experiência exigidas
Mínimo de 4 anos de experiência profissional em desenvolvimento backend em Java.
Sólidos conhecimentos de Java e dos princípios de desenvolvimento backend.
Experiência com Spring Boot e frameworks relacionados.
Experiência no desenvolvimento e utilização de APIs RESTful.
Familiaridade com bases de dados relacionais (por exemplo, PostgreSQL, MySQL, Oracle).
Experiência com sistemas de controlo de versões, como o Git.
Compreensão da arquitetura de software e padrões de design.
Boas competências de resolução de problemas e analíticas.
Requisitos linguísticos
Nível de inglês B2 a C1 (obrigatório).
Informações adicionais
Modelo de trabalho híbrido com base no Porto.
Disponibilidade para começar em julho ou agosto.

Navitas Partners, LLC

ERGO NEXT Group INTERNAL

Caris Life Sciences

Rapinno Health Care

Orbital Engineering, Inc.

Irium Portugal

Irium Portugal